H3: Forging Your Own: From Belts to Masterpieces
You can build a goth harness outfit from raw materials. This is true rebellion. Look at old belts, discarded straps, and spare hardware. These items become your tools. Cut leather strips. You can use old belts for this purpose. Attach buckles and D-rings. A strong punch tool makes holes. You need rivets to secure connections. Webbing material also works. It is very durable. Plan your design first. Sketch how the straps will cross your body. Measure your form accurately. You must cut your materials to these sizes. Stitch pieces together strongly. Heavy-duty thread is best. Or, use rivets for a tougher look. This method makes a unique piece. It shows your skill. It is a true mark of defiance.
H3: Modifying the Mundane: Customizing Store-Bought Harnesses
Buying a goth harness outfit is simple. But you can make it truly yours. A basic store-bought harness is a canvas. It waits for your personal touch. Add chains. You can drape them across the chest or waist. Attach spikes or studs. These make a bold statement. Use fabric paint to add symbols or patterns. Think about your personal aesthetic. You can replace original buckles with more elaborate ones. Find unique hardware at craft stores. It changes the whole feel. Sew on patches. Or, add lace for a softer contrast. Distress the leather. Sandpaper or a sharp knife can do this job. This customization turns a common item into a personal artifact. It reflects your true spirit.
